Bridget has a limited income and consumes only wine and cheese; her current con- sumption choice is four bottles of wine and 10 pounds of cheese. The price of wine is $10 per bottle, and the price of cheese is $4 per pound. The last bottle of wine added 50 units to Bridget's utility, while the last pound of cheese added 40 units.
a. Is Bridget making the utility-maximizing choice?Why or why not?
b. Ifnot,what should she do instead?Why?
